Jerusalem, Israel - Apr. 20, 2017 - The Tower of David provided an inspirational setting for the "Inspired by Israel" video contest Milstein Awards Ceremony in Jerusalem, Israel, on Tuesday night, after Passover ended.

 

With sponsors, Adam and Gila Milstein Family Foundation, 12 Tribes Foundation, Jerusalem Wine Club and Root Source, former Baltimorean Avi Abelow, co-founder and CEO of IsraeVideoNetwork.com, presented cash awards to winning film makers. Ten of the international videos were shown, the winners selected from dozens, submitted from around the world, Jewish and none Jewish film makers.

After on-line voting, a panel of judges decided on the winning videos. Ari Abramowitz, film maker and educator, acted as MC. Jerusalem Mayor Nir Barkat congratulated all on the great work done by "Israel Inspired."


The Grand Prize winner was Home is Never Simple  by Sivan Felder and Batsheva Schahnovitz.

Concluding the program was a beautiful rendition of Hatikvah, featuring former Pikesville resident Ariella Zeitlin on violin.
